For me the lure of diving DT wore off long, long ago in the 80's. It's still a dive that is always requested with the groups that we lead to the island, even today. Knowing the hazards of the swim through and depth, I have no issues being selective of those that are 'invited' to do the dive. I'm also fortunate that the operator I currently use also limits the ratio to 4:1. This hasn't always been the case, having used operators that called it a normal dive.

LOL, old post. I hope they had a good dive. :) If you don't feel comfortable about it, you shouldn't do it. Don't worry, it's Coz's bogeyman dive. Probably shouldn't be your first deep dive nor your first swimthrough. There are plenty of other dives. That said once you build up your comfort level with a bit more Coz experience, give it a try. I find it to be an interesting swimthrough with some lovely topography and beautiful vistas. All IMHO, YMMV. Enjoy or not :). :clearmask:
